A traditional German stein beer. Hot granite is used to assist the boil, which adds a smokey caramel flavour to this already complex beer

Tap at the Briarbank, Ipswich. Pours ruby brown with a small lasting bubbly off-white head. Arom of malt, caramel, chocolate and fruit. Moderate sweetness and medium bitterness. Medium body, slight creamy texture, soft carbonation.

Clear deep amber beer, good pale cream colour head. Palate is airy and semi dry. Good fine carbonation. Fluffy semi dry malts, thin creamy sweetness. Whisper of smoke. Pretty tangy fruits, little lemon. Light semi dry finish. Not bad.
